Output 576067cd6761da62fa7c7676657ac10e048cebcd552716489944a22597d55166:12

value
8854761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a7098c369ac5602285b65a05435fc6f05e4338 OP_EQUAL
address
3KLxSXDap6hEYRrj26eAoC9ed1sizcUfpq
transaction
576067cd6761da62fa7c7676657ac10e048cebcd552716489944a22597d55166
spent
true